Output 73d84a5fc8a1cd58b1b13d2b3421e75b7e97d168a96ec1456b734ec9706337ab:0

value
26386668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ba6ccf8890bbb2c981d907a9ca83dba8028085 OP_EQUAL
address
3L5f597PoF8k2N3eTcsEQtz8n27idprFE6
transaction
73d84a5fc8a1cd58b1b13d2b3421e75b7e97d168a96ec1456b734ec9706337ab
spent
true